DIRECTIVE 2006/32/EC (ESD)Key directive for creation of overall framework for EE:

Indicative energy savings targets (min 9 % for the 9 years of implementation),

National Energy Efficiency Action Plans (NEEAPs)

Exemplary role of the public sector, EE criteria in public procurement,

Improvement of end-users’ energy efficiency

Obligation of the energy companies,

Intelligent metering systems,

Innovative EE financial instruments,

Energy auditing system,

Procedures for monitoring and verification of energy savings , etc.

Key transposition approaches: preparation of general EE law or extensive chapter in energy law + changes in procurement law + package of secondary legislation

DIRECTIVE 2010/31/EU (EPBD)Focused on EE improvements in building stock:

Methodology for calculating the integrated energy performance of buildings,

Minimum EP requirements for new and existing buildings, building units and technical building systems,

Certification of buildings,

Financial incentives,

Regular inspection of heating and air-conditioning systems,

“Nearly zero-energy buildings” - concept and plans.

Key transposition approaches: amendments of the law for buildings + certain provisions in EE law + package of secondary legislation and standards

DIRECTIVE 2010/30/EU (ELD)Labels help consumers choosing energy efficient product.

Framework Directive establishes the legal framework for labelling and consumer information regarding energy consumption for energy-related products:

Obligations for dealers and suppliers,

Public procurement ,

Conditions for distance selling, etc.

The delegated regulations deal with the labelling of specific energy-related products:

Tumble driers, air conditioners, dishwashers, refrigerators, washing machines, TVs…

Key transposition approaches: Basic provisions in EE Law (framework directive) + Technical Regulations for Energy Labelling + standards

EU - NEW EE DIRECTIVE 2012/27/EU EU – ADOPTED IN NOVEMBER 2012, TRANSPOSITION BY JUNE 2014

TO ENSURE THE ACHIEVEMENT OF THE EU 2020 20 % TARGET ON EE

MORE COMPREHENSIVE NEEAPS >> DEMAND AND SUPPLY SIDE

STRICTER MEASURES: public sector, energy audits, energy management, EE obligation schemes ..

ENERGY COMMUNITY APPROACH:

RECOMMENDATIONS IN 2013 (VOLUNTARY APPROACH)

ASSESSMENT OF THE IMPACT OF THE DIRECTIVE 2012/27/EU, IF ADOPTED BY CPs (2013-2014)

ADOPTION IN 2014 (UPON DECISION OF MC)

CONTRACTING PARTIES - COMMON CHARACTERISTICS AND BARRIERS• High potential for EE and RES, especially hydro, biomass, wind, solar

• Many existing barriers to are still slowing down the implementation of EE and RES policies. New legislation, but real implementation is still a challenge.

• The vast investment needs for major retrofit, and new power plants

• CPs are facing more barriers to financing energy efficiency than EU Member States (economic structure, public budget constraints, lower income etc). Severe effect of economic and financial crisis - substantially reducing economic growth rates, decreasing investment and increasing poverty rates, increase of public debt and the general financial insolvency of the public sector

• Low electricity prices, well below cost recovery level, especially for residential consumers

• Lack of information, skills and practical knowledge of both the providers and the end users of services (too good to be true symptom!!!)

• Need for a strengthened regional cooperation
